@charset "UTF-8";/* CSS Document */img {	border:0;}li {	list-style:disc;}a {	color:#870150;	text-decoration:none;}a:hover {	color:#000;	text-decoration:none;}.bld {	font-weight:bold;}.cent {	text-align:center;}#mastHead {	width:970px;	padding:0;	margin:0;}#vPlayer {	float:right;	text-align:center;	margin:0 0 20px 0;	padding:0;}#mainContainer {	margin:-11px 0 0px 0;	padding:0px 0 10px;	width:500px;		}.mainContainer {	width:490px;	background:#fff;	padding:5px;}.btmPlr {	width:329px;	height:19px;	background:URL(http://www.bulldogreporter.com/Media/DesignImageLibrary/bttmPlayer.png) repeat-x;	margin:-20px 0 0 1px;}.sepver {	width:329px;	height:19px;	background:URL(http://www.bulldogreporter.com/Media/DesignImageLibrary/bttmPlayer.png) repeat-x;	margin:5px -1px 5px 1px;}.mHead {	float:left;	margin:10px 30px 10px 5px;}#date {	float:right;	font-size:14px;	font-weight:bold;	margin:0px 20px 0px 0px;	padding:0;}.sponsors {	margin:0px 0 5px 450px;}.sponsors img {	margin:5px;}.sponBy {	float:left;	font-family:Verdana, Arial, sans-serif;	font-size:13px;	font-weight:bold;	margin:20px 50px 0px 100px;}.rss {	background:url(http://www.iralert.com/Media/DesignImageLibrary/ir-rss_0.png) 8px 3px no-repeat;	border-left:#000 1px solid;	display:block;	float:right;	height:17px;	margin-left:5px;	margin-top:0px;	/*padding-top:2px;*/	text-align:right;	width:60px;}.btmrt {	 float:right;	 margin:0 30px 0 0;	 width:240px;}.bar {	text-align:right;	width:976px;	height:3px;	margin:0;	background:#870150;}/* WB for IE browser  */.whBar {	height:3px;	width:10px;	margin:0 331px 0 630px;	background:#fff;}/*  white box on red bar for safari et al */.bar > .whBar {	height:3px;	width:10px;	margin:0 330px 0 635px;	background:#fff;}.clear {	clear:both;}.rtRail {	/*background:#e7e7e7;*/	margin:0;	padding:0;	text-align:center;	width:330px;}.ltRail {	margin:0;	padding:0;	width:145px;	text-align:center;}.tag {	margin:5px 0 10px 5px;}.email {	text-align:center;	padding:0 0 5px;	margin:0 0 15px;	width:330px;	height:125px;	float:right;	color:#fff;	background:#000;	border-left:#870150 1px solid;}.email b {	margin:25px 0 0;	display:block;	/*color:#870150;*/	font-size:16px;	font-weight:bold;}.email form {	margin:10px;	padding:0;}.emailTxt {	margin:5px 0 10px 5px;	font-size:14px;	font-weight:bold;}.sub {	display:block;	margin:5px auto 20px;}.ads {	margin:10px 5px;}.rtAds {	margin:20px 0 15px 0;	padding:0;}.verSep {	height:3px; 	border-bottom:#ccc solid 2px;	margin:8px 10px;}.redR {	border-bottom:#870150 1px solid;	height:10px;}.verSepRt {	height:2px;	border-bottom:#ccc solid 2px;	margin:8px 5px;}.title {	font-family:Georgia, "Times New Roman", Times, serif;	margin:10px 50px 5px 10px;	padding-bottom:3px;	font-size:20px;	font-weight:bold;	color:#870150;	border-bottom:#870150 1px dotted;}/*  top section title  */.titleTp {	font-family:Georgia, "Times New Roman", Times, serif;	margin:10px 50px 5px 10px;	padding:10px 0 3px;	font-size:20px;	font-weight:bold;	color:#870150;	border-bottom:#870150 1px dotted;}/* right column section headers  */.titleRt {	font-family:Georgia, "Times New Roman", Times, serif;	margin:10px 50px 5px 10px;	padding-bottom:3px;	text-align:left;	font-size:20px;	font-weight:bold;	color:#870150;	border-bottom:#870150 1px dotted;}.titleRtSm {	font-family:Georgia, "Times New Roman", Times, serif;	margin:0px 50px 5px 10px;	padding-bottom:3px;	text-align:left;	font-size:12px;	font-weight:bold;	color:#870150;}/*   video player section header  */.titleVid {	font-family:Georgia, "Times New Roman", Times, serif;	padding:15px 5px 5px 5px;	margin:0;	text-align:left;	font-size:20px;	font-weight:bold;	color:#870150;	/*border-top:#870150 2px solid;*/}/*   IRU section tag text */.iru {	margin-top:10px;}.iruTag {	font-size:18px;	font-weight:bold;	color:#870150;	margin:8px 0 3px;}/* background shadow for photos *//* ie browsers  */div.photo-sm {	float: left;	margin: 10px 5px 5px 5px;	padding: 0 4px 8px 0;	background:URL(http://www.bulldogreporter.com/Media/DesignImageLibrary/shdw-sm_1.png) no-repeat bottom right;}/* safari et al  */div > .photo-sm {	float: left;	margin: 10px 5px 5px 5px;	padding: 0 7px 8px 0;	background:URL(http://www.bulldogreporter.com/Media/DesignImageLibrary/shdw-sm_1.png) no-repeat bottom right;}/*  ie browsers  */div.photo-sm img {	float: left;	display: block;	position: relative;	margin: -5px 0 0 -8px;	border: 1px solid #870150;}/*  Safari et al  */div > .photo-sm > img {	float: left;	display: block;	margin: -5px 0px 0px -5px;	border: 1px solid #870150;}/*   Search Box styles   */.searchBx {	margin:5px 5px 10px;	color:#fff;	text-align:center;	font-size:14px;}.searchBx strong {	display:block;	margin:15px 0 12px;}.QuickSearchWidth {	width:100px;}/*   Colours   */.dred {	color:#870150;}/*   font   */.lg {	font-size:16px;}/*   IRA Poll   */#IRpoll p {	text-align:left;}#IRpoll .sm {	font-size:9px;	font-weight:bold;}#IRpoll a:hover {	border-bottom:#870150 1px dotted;}#IRpoll .titleRt {	font-family:Georgia, "Times New Roman", Times, serif;	margin:10px 10px 5px 10px;	padding-bottom:3px;	text-align:left;	font-size:20px;	font-weight:bold;	color:#870150;	border-bottom:#870150 1px dotted;	}#IRpoll .titleRtSm {	font-family:Georgia, "Times New Roman", Times, serif;	margin:0px 20px 5px 10px;	padding-bottom:3px;	text-align:left;	font-size:12px;	font-weight:bold;	color:#870150;}/*   IR Univeristy styles  */#rail .sched {	padding:5px 0px;	width:100%;	background:#000;	margin:0 0 10px;	color:#fff;	font-size:14px;	font-weight:bold;}#iru .nav img {	text-align:center;	margin:10px auto;	width:300px;}#iru .nav {	width:500px;	background:#ddd;	text-align:center;	margin:-10px -8px 0;	padding:10px 0px 10px;	border-bottom: #000 solid 3px;}	#iru > .nav {	background:#ddd;	text-align:center;	margin:-10px -8px 0;	padding:10px 0px 8px;	border-bottom: #000 solid 3px;}#iru .subNav {	float:left;	margin:0px 5px 5px 15px;	font-weight:bold;}#iru {	width:484px;	padding:10px 8px;	font-size:12px;}#iru h1 {	text-align:center;	color:#870150;	font-size:20px;}#iru .sched {	padding:5px 10px;	width:502px;	background:#000;	margin:0 -10px 10px;	color:#fff;	font-size:16px;	font-weight:bold;}#iru .conSched a {	color:#870150;	text-decoration:none;	font-size:14px;	font-weight:bold;}#iru .conSched a:hover {	color:#cd0d7e;}#faq .dred {	color:#870150;	font-weight:bold;}/*   Inline ad styles   */.ilAd {	margin:0 1.5em 1.5em;	padding:.5em;	border:#870150 1px solid;	font-weight:normal;}.ilAd b {	font-size:1.1em;	font-weight:bold;}.content {	padding:.5em;	margin:.5em 0 1.25em;}